Nina Elkadi
Nina B. Elkadi is an Editor-at-Large for Sentient. Her investigative reporting explores corporate influence within the agricultural industry, the environmental impacts of factory farming, and how negligence impacts consumers and workers. Her work also appears in National Geographic, Inside Climate News, Civil Eats, High Country News, Ambrook Research, JSTOR Daily, Barn Raiser and more. She splits her time between Washington D.C. and her hometown of Iowa City.
